mysql怎么变换提示符
时间 : 2023-03-08 01:22: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

MySQL命令行客户端有一个较通用的命令prompt,它使用户可以在控制台中更改提示符的文本。此命令设置所谓的“定制提示符”,您可以使用该命令以将变量和文本组合在一起,以创建所需的提示符文本。

默认的“定制提示符”语法如下:

```mysql

prompt Set1, Set2, ...

这里,Set1,Set2 ... 表示分隔符,可以是任何文本,但是它们必须被引用。默认分隔符是>字符。如果文本中有空格或特殊字符,需要使用引号将其括起来。注意,在使用引号时要注意引号和转义符。

例如,以下命令更改提示符:

```mysql

mysql> prompt "Enter your command > "

Enter your command >

此时,提示符变为“Enter your command > ”。

除此之外,还可以使用MySQL内置变量来组合提示符。

下面是MySQL内置变量的一些示例:

```mysql

variable | definition

==================================================================================

MYSQL_PS1 | SET interactive prompt for mysql command prompt.

MYSQL_PS2 | SET interactive prompt for mysql continuation prompt.

MYSQL_PS3 | SET interactive prompt for multi-line command.

MYSQL_PS4 | SET interactive prompt for mysql debug prompt.

以下是使用MYSQL_PS1变量创建自定义的提示符的命令:

mysql> SET MYSQL_PS1 = "mysql [\d] >"

mysql [test] >

通过修改以上变量,您可以自定义MySQL提示符,以适合您的个性化需求。

总结:MySQL提示符可以通过修改系统环境变量或使用prompt命令自定义。系统环境变量和MySQL内置变量都可以自由地组合以创建适合您需求的定制提示符。